The First Home Scheme, which is managed by First Home Scheme Ireland Designated Activity Company (First Home DAC) on behalf of scheme founders (the State, Bank of Ireland, Allied Irish Bank and PTSB), launched on 7 July 2022. It supports first-time buyers in purchasing new houses and apartments in the private market through the use of an equity share model. Full details of the First Home Scheme, including details of the price ceilings, which were revised on 1 January 2023, are available on the dedicated scheme website: www.firsthomescheme.ie.
Currently, the scheme applies nationwide to newly-built homes in private developments. In line with Action 1.2 of the Housing for All Action Plan Update (November 2022), I have requested the First Home DAC to consider the potential to expand the scheme to cover self-builds. This includes the governance, financial and operational implications and First Home DAC will revert to me on completion of this exercise.
